Output fe71c7e84bac8a52c83953d0c15acdfb00a7a91e83da991e0cf388db47684319:1

value
593383
script pubkey
OP_HASH160 OP_PUSHBYTES_20 823c3239bb3a3d5695a19796ad5096ef83ec1515 OP_EQUAL
address
3DZdszB1YtnuDParKr6tegWmjSBgLbL3q7
transaction
fe71c7e84bac8a52c83953d0c15acdfb00a7a91e83da991e0cf388db47684319
confirmations
351447
spent
true